Cody, Your pump considerations will need to include the location of the sump in respect to the display. If you are keeping the sump below the display, the pump will need to be pressure rated to be able to make the ascent needed to reach the display. otherwise, the head loss could be significant enough where the pump will pump little if any water.

Also, on your overflow, you will need to have a box on the back side of the tank as well. the box on the back will regulate the flow through the u-tube and will also prevent the water from dropping below the u-tube causing the syphon to break and the overflow to cease.

Here is a standard overflow design. I'm sure modifications can be made to accomodate a smaller design that would be less intrusive to your 10 gal tank.
